By Mohamed Foday Conteh
Mohamed Conteh, a 56 year-old man who is on trial for alleged sexual abuse of a then 17 year-old girl described as his daughter since sittings on the case began, has told Justice Momoh-Jah Stevens that the girl is not his ‘biological daughter’.
Conteh, a mechanic,made the claim as he testified at the Sexual Offences Model Court in Freetown on Friday 22 October this year, over allegations of incest levied on him by the State.
He was arraigned in court for a crime that he was accused of having started since 2017 and continued to August last year.
The prosecution led in a total of two witnesses including the victim and one of the Police investigators in the matter.
The victim told the judge that her father had sex with her at hotels in Lungi and Kambia, two towns where she was taken for exorcism for alleged witchcraft accusation heaped upon her by the accused. She claimed to have been abandoned and left with traditional healers in both Lungi and Kambia.
The Police investigator said that they went to the hotels in question in Lungi and Kambia and found panties that belonged to the victim. The officer also produced two endorsed medical request forms on the physicality and pregnancy of the girl after she reportedly got pregnant as a result of the sexual abuse. She later gave birth at the Aberdeen Women’s Centre in Freetown but =the baby died.
Lawyer Sesay closed his case on Friday 22 October, making reference to one of the endorsed medical forms that stated the girl got impregnated. He said that the prosecution has provided enough evidence to convict the father.
The defence led by Cecil Campbell opened their case with the accused Conteh as first Defence Witness (DW1).
The accused said that the whole issue started in 2016 when he was evicted from his Juba residence and had to plead with one of his friends to grant him a room for two of his daughters and the victim.
Conteh claimed he has only three biological daughters and that the victim was not one of them. He told the judge that he only knew her when she was five months old. He said the mother of the girl who was his girlfriend had left her in his living room early in the morning of 2001, but later came with four people to take custody of her again.
During cross-examination, the accused said that he and the mother of the victim had an intimate affair and even had a child who passed away some time ago. He told the judge that the victim used to carry another surname until age nine.
He admitted to have stayed with the girl at a certain guest house in Kambia for seven months but was never aware she was pregnant in 2020, until March this year. He denied having a fight with her while they were staying in the guest house in Kambia.
In re-examination by the defence lawyer, Conteh said the girl used to carry a ‘Johnson’ surname and not his.
Justice Stevens adjourned the matter to the 1st November 2021 with Conteh remanded in prison. The defence intend to bring in more witnesses in the matter to testify for the accused.
